Days after a massive Ukrainian drone attack on Russian bombers, President Vladimir Putin has promised revenge, while on a phone call with U.S. President Donald Trump. The call happened during a NATO defence ministers’ meeting, which included Canada’s Defence Minister David McGuinty but not U.S. Defence Secretary Pete Hegseth. Nathaniel Dove reports on the meeting and the latest Russian attacks on Ukraine.
